    This study presents a universal rectifier for complex coagulation blood system investigations. Its novel electromagnetic system enhances operational and metrological performance for accurate blood analysis.

    Area of Science:

    • Biomedical Engineering
    • Hematology
    • Electromagnetism

    Context:

    • Accurate investigation of the coagulation blood system is crucial for diagnosing and managing various hemostatic disorders.
    • Existing methods for analyzing coagulation parameters may face limitations in precision and operational efficiency.
    • The development of advanced diagnostic tools is essential for improving patient outcomes.

    Purpose:

    • To introduce a universal rectifier designed for the complex investigation of the coagulation blood system.
    • To achieve high operational and metrological parameters in rectifying homogeneous physical values.
    • To enhance the accuracy and simplify calculations in coagulation analysis.

    Summary:

    • The study details a universal rectifier employing a cylinder differential electromagnetic system with distributed magnetic and concentrated electrical parameters.

  • This design enables rectification of homogeneous physical values in both direct and reverse modes.
  • An electromagnetic excitation system allows for error correction by adjusting excitation coil current, simplifying system calculations.
  • Impact:

    • The developed rectifier offers improved accuracy and efficiency in coagulation blood system analysis.
    • This technology has the potential to advance diagnostic capabilities in hematology.
    • Simplification of calculations can lead to faster and more reliable diagnostic results.
